When it comes to the direction of rotation of a centrifugal pump, it is crucial to understand that this is always determined when facing the shaft. This rule applies not only to the pump shaft but also to the drive shaft. Centrifugal Pump Running Backwards

One of the common issues that can arise with centrifugal pumps is when they run backwards. This can happen if the pump is not installed correctly or if there is a problem with the motor or drive system. When a centrifugal pump runs backwards, it can lead to inefficiency, increased wear and tear on the pump components, and ultimately, pump failure.

Reverse Flow Water Pump Problems

Reverse flow in a water pump can cause a range of problems, including decreased pump performance, cavitation, and potential damage to the pump impeller. It is important to ensure that the pump is installed correctly and that the direction of rotation is in line with the manufacturer's specifications to prevent reverse flow issues.

Centrifugal Pump Impeller Direction

The direction of rotation of a centrifugal pump impeller is crucial for optimal pump performance. The impeller is designed to rotate in a specific direction to create the necessary flow and pressure within the pump. If the impeller is spinning in the wrong direction, it can lead to inefficiency, cavitation, and potential damage to the pump components.

Clockwise Direction of Rotation

In many centrifugal pumps, the preferred direction of rotation is clockwise. This is often indicated by the manufacturer and should be followed during installation and operation. A clockwise rotation ensures that the pump operates efficiently and effectively, delivering the desired flow and pressure for the application.

Centrifugal Pump Spinning Direction

The spinning direction of a centrifugal pump is determined by the direction of rotation of the impeller. When the impeller rotates in the correct direction, it creates a centrifugal force that pushes the fluid through the pump and out into the system. If the impeller is spinning in the wrong direction, it can disrupt the flow and performance of the pump.

Pump Impeller Rotation Direction

The rotation direction of the pump impeller is crucial for proper pump operation. The impeller is designed to spin in a specific direction to create the necessary flow and pressure within the pump. It is important to ensure that the impeller is rotating in the correct direction to prevent issues such as cavitation, reduced efficiency, and potential damage to the pump.
